Ticket: Key cabinet for the pool cars in the Marsten Yard garage is jamming again. Replacement cabinet installed this morning, same wall, left of the charging points. All fobs transferred and checked against the vehicle log. Old cabinet will be collected Friday — do not store anything in it. New cabinet locks automatically after thirty seconds. Open it with the combination below.

door code, yagap-bahof: bdg-O-05

Subject: DeployParrot cut-over complete

Team — the cut-over to DeployParrot as our deploy-status bot finished Tuesday night. The old poller is decommissioned and all channels now receive status updates from the new service. Latency on status replies dropped noticeably, and the fallback webhook path was verified under load. No incidents during the switch. For reference, the bot is running with the following configuration values.

settings of tagef-bawif:
DRUIX_HOST=druix.zemvarlabs.internal
DRUIX_PORT=8000

The garage occupancy feed for the Brindlewood campus arrives over a message queue every thirty seconds, one record per level, published by the Stallgrid edge boxes. Counts can briefly go negative when a sensor double-fires on exit; the ingest job clamps these to zero and flags the interval. If the feed stalls for more than five minutes, the dashboard falls back to the last known snapshot. Sensor mappings, queue names, and the replay procedure are documented on the internal page below.

runbook for tahog-kadug: https://gitlab.qirvanworks.corp/projects/pages/view/b139298aed28

## Build Provenance: SpokeShift Rebalancer

SpokeShift, the rebalancing tool for the Varelo bike-share network, is compiled exclusively by the Ironvale pipeline from protected branches. Maintainers should know that the optimizer binary embeds its dependency graph digest at link time, and the deploy gate compares this against the registry record. If the digests diverge, the rollout halts automatically. Manual overrides require two approvals and are logged permanently. The provenance token for the active release is recorded immediately below.

trace token, fafog-kageg: htk4_98e6